The Shadow of Neon Nexus
The neon-lit streets of the Cyberpunk Cathedral were a labyrinth of towering skyscrapers and sprawling alleyways. Paperinik, the enigmatic vigilante, had been a fixture in this neon-drenched metropolis for years. His alter ego, PK, was a symbol of hope to many, but today, his world was about to change forever.
As he navigated through the bustling crowd, the city's air was thick with anticipation. The annual Neon Nexus festival was in full swing, a celebration of technology and art that brought together the brightest minds of the cyberpunk world. But beneath the surface, something sinister was brewing.
Paperinik's senses were heightened, his eyes scanning the crowd for any sign of trouble. Suddenly, a familiar voice echoed through the cathedral, drawing his attention to a grand stage. There, standing before a sea of adoring fans, was the city's most powerful figure, the enigmatic leader of the Neon Nexus, known only as The Architect.
"The time has come for a new dawn," The Architect declared, his voice resonating with authority. "We will reshape the city, and those who resist will be eliminated."
As Paperinik watched, a chill ran down his spine. The Architect's words were a stark reminder of the power he held, and the lengths he would go to maintain it. But something about The Architect's demeanor felt off, as if he was hiding something.
Determined to uncover the truth, Paperinik decided to investigate further. He slipped away from the crowd, his cloak a perfect match for the shadowy alleys of the cathedral. His first stop was the Neon Nexus headquarters, a towering structure that loomed over the city.
Inside, Paperinik encountered a group of scientists, hunched over their workstations, their faces illuminated by the glow of screens. He approached one of them, a young woman with a determined look in her eyes.
"Who is The Architect?" Paperinik asked, his voice low.
The woman looked up, her eyes wide with fear. "He is the mastermind behind the Neon Nexus. But he is not who he seems."
Before she could say more, the alarms blared, and the room was flooded with security guards. Paperinik was forced to flee, his cloak billowing behind him as he disappeared into the darkness.
His next stop was the underground resistance, a group of rebels fighting against The Architect's regime. They met in a hidden bar, its walls adorned with graffiti and the smell of stale beer permeating the air.
"Paperinik, we need your help," one of the rebels said, his voice urgent. "The Architect is planning something huge. We need to stop him before it's too late."
Paperinik nodded, understanding the gravity of the situation. "I'll help you, but I need to know what The Architect is planning."
The rebels led him to a secret room, where they presented him with a set of blueprints. "This is the project he's been working on," one of them said. "The Neon Nexus is about to become a city of nightmares."
As Paperinik studied the blueprints, he noticed something peculiar. There was a hidden symbol, one that seemed to be a key to unlocking a deeper conspiracy. He knew he had to follow the trail of this symbol, no matter where it led.
His next stop was the home of a former Neon Nexus scientist, who had defected and gone into hiding. The scientist met him in an abandoned warehouse, his face pale and his eyes filled with fear.
"Paperinik, you have to believe me," the scientist said. "The Architect is using the Neon Nexus to create a new kind of weapon. It's called the Cybernetic Swarm."
Paperinik's heart raced. The Cybernetic Swarm was a terrifying concept, a network of interconnected robots that could be controlled by a single mind. "How do we stop it?" he asked.
The scientist looked at him, his eyes filled with hope. "We need to find the source code and destroy it. But it's hidden deep within the Neon Nexus."
With the source code in mind, Paperinik set off on a perilous journey through the Neon Nexus. He encountered a series of challenges, from patrolling security robots to corrupt officials who would do anything to stop him.
As he delved deeper into the city, Paperinik began to uncover the truth about The Architect. He learned that The Architect was once a hero, a brilliant scientist who had developed the Neon Nexus to improve the lives of the city's inhabitants. But somewhere along the way, he had become corrupted by power, and his vision had turned dark.
With this knowledge, Paperinik knew he had to make a difficult decision. He could either destroy the source code and bring down The Architect, or he could try to save him from his own descent into madness.
As he approached the final chamber, Paperinik found himself standing before a massive computer terminal. The source code was hidden within, a digital labyrinth that would require his full attention to navigate.
With a deep breath, Paperinik began to work. He moved through the code, his fingers flying over the keyboard, until he reached the core. There, he found a hidden message, a final plea from The Architect.
"Paperinik, I made a mistake. I was blinded by ambition. Please, help me correct it."
Paperinik paused, his heart heavy. He had to choose between saving The Architect and saving the city. He looked at the screen, and in that moment, he knew what he had to do.
With a final keystroke, Paperinik deleted the source code, destroying the Cybernetic Swarm. The Neon Nexus was saved, but at a cost. The Architect was gone, his legacy forever tarnished.
As Paperinik emerged from the chamber, he looked around at the city he had saved. The Neon Nexus was still a place of wonder and innovation, but now it was also a place of hope.
He turned to leave, his cloak flapping behind him as he disappeared into the night. The city was safe, but the battle against corruption was far from over. And as Paperinik knew, he would always be there to fight for the truth, no matter the cost.
